What Factors Should You Consider When Choosing AA Batteries for Cameras?
When choosing the best AA batteries for cameras, several factors should be considered to ensure optimal performance and longevity.
- Battery Type: The two primary types of AA batteries are alkaline and lithium. Alkaline batteries are often cheaper but may not perform well in high-drain devices like cameras, while lithium batteries provide longer life and better performance in extreme temperatures, making them more suitable for photography.
- Capacity (mAh): The capacity of a battery, measured in milliamp hours (mAh), indicates how much energy it can store. Higher capacity batteries can last longer before needing replacement, which is crucial for extended shooting sessions or when using power-intensive features like flash.
- Self-Discharge Rate: Some batteries lose their charge over time even when not in use, known as the self-discharge rate. Rechargeable NiMH batteries have a higher self-discharge rate than lithium, but newer low self-discharge NiMH batteries retain their charge longer, making them more reliable for cameras used infrequently.
- Cost: While cheaper batteries can save you money upfront, their shorter lifespan and performance may lead to higher costs in the long run. Investing in high-quality batteries can enhance your camera’s performance and reduce the frequency of replacements.
- Brand Reputation: Choosing reputable brands can provide assurance of quality and performance. Well-known brands often undergo rigorous testing and quality control, ensuring that their batteries meet the demands of high-performance devices like cameras.
- Environmental Considerations: Consider the environmental impact of battery disposal and choose rechargeable options when possible. Rechargeable batteries reduce waste and are more eco-friendly, as they can be used multiple times before needing replacement.
How Does Battery Chemistry Affect Camera Performance?
The chemistry of batteries significantly influences the performance, longevity, and reliability of cameras.
- Alkaline Batteries: Alkaline batteries are common and widely available, providing a moderate energy output and good shelf life. However, they can struggle to perform in high-drain devices like digital cameras, leading to rapid depletion and inconsistent power delivery.
- Lithium Batteries: Lithium batteries offer a higher energy density and can operate efficiently in extreme temperatures. They provide a longer lifespan and more stable voltage levels, making them ideal for high-performance cameras that require sustained energy for features like flash and continuous shooting.
- NiMH Rechargeable Batteries: Nickel-Metal Hydride (NiMH) batteries are popular for their rechargeable nature and can deliver a high current output, which is beneficial for powering cameras during intensive tasks. They tend to have a lower self-discharge rate compared to other rechargeable types, ensuring they retain charge when not in use, although they may not match the voltage stability of lithium options.
- NiCd Rechargeable Batteries: Nickel-Cadmium (NiCd) batteries are less common nowadays due to their lower capacity and memory effect, but they are still used in some applications. They can provide reliable performance in high-drain devices but are less efficient and environmentally friendly compared to newer chemistries like NiMH and lithium.

What Storage Tips Help Maintain Battery Life for Camera Use?
To maintain battery life for camera use, consider the following storage tips:
- Store in a Cool, Dry Place: Batteries should be stored in a temperature-controlled environment, ideally between 20-25°C (68-77°F), as excessive heat can lead to faster degradation.
- Avoid Humidity: High humidity can cause corrosion and damage to battery contacts, so keeping batteries in a desiccant-lined case can help absorb moisture.
- Keep Contacts Clean: Regularly check and clean battery terminals with a soft cloth to ensure good conductivity and prevent energy loss.
- Remove Batteries When Not in Use: If you’re storing your camera for an extended period, take out the batteries to prevent leakage and corrosion that can occur when batteries are left in devices.
- Use Battery Cases: Investing in a protective battery case can prevent physical damage and keep batteries organized, reducing the risk of accidental short circuits.
- Charge Properly: Always charge rechargeable batteries according to the manufacturer’s instructions, avoiding overcharging, which can shorten their lifespan.
Storing batteries in a cool, dry place helps to avoid the heat that can cause chemical reactions, leading to reduced capacity over time. Keeping batteries away from humidity is crucial since moisture can corrode the battery terminals and affect their functionality.
Cleaning the contacts ensures that your batteries maintain a good connection with your camera, preventing energy loss and ensuring optimal performance. Removing batteries from devices during long-term storage is essential to avoid any leakage that battery chemicals might cause to the device.
Using a battery case not only protects batteries from physical damage but also aids in organization, making it easier to keep track of your supplies. Proper charging practices are vital as well; following the manufacturer’s guidelines helps to maximize battery lifespan and effectiveness.
